Get In Training For Olympic Year At Beverley Minster

Minster is offering all-comers the chance to begin a healthy new year and get in condition for the Olympics by opening its towers on Bank Holiday Monday (2nd January).

As is now traditional on Bank Holidays the Minster is offering special tours inside the roof that include the unique clock mechanism in the north and south towers.

Also included on the tours is a demonstration of the largest working tread wheel crane in Britain and superb views over East Yorkshire.

Climbing nearly 90 feet to see these will do wonders for any New Year weight-loss and muscle-building regime!

Bank Holiday Monday is also the last chance to see the special fine-scale railway model of in the 1930s actually in operation before it is removed from the Minster.

Entrance is free – roof tours are £5 for adults and £2.50 for under 16s, starting at 9.30am and running through the day.

No bookings are required.
